AroundPtown.com was started in 2015 by Dan Eyrich, a Prophetstown native with a 20-year career as a TV photojournalist. He credits his son Josh for the idea of bringing news and information to a small town on a web platform. After beginning to cover local activities on Facebook, Dan decided to move his endeavor to the web and make it a full-time job. In 2023, Dan and his wife, Sue, moved to Fort W

ayne, Indiana, to be closer to their grandchildren as they look forward to retirement. The business was sold to Janel Stahr of Rock Falls, who also owns and operates Stahr Media, along with her husband, Nathan. While their business focuses on website user experience and development, print graphic design and marketing, they both have a rich history in and passion for the news business. After meeting while both employed for the local newspaper, Janel went on to work for an agri-business magazine company and together they ran a weekly entertainment newspaper for two years. While getting started with Stahr Media, they also designed, edited and wrote for a local monthly newspaper. From 2010-2020, Nathan served as the IT director at PLT CUSD #3. Judith R. Barnett, 78, died Monday July 1, 2024 at Citadel of Sterling.

She was born on June 5, 1946 in Clinton, IA the daughter of Eugene V. and Mildred (Herington) Paulsen. She married Robert D. Barnett on June 19, 1972 in Morrison. He died March 8, 2017. She enjoyed playing bingo, camping but most of all spending time with her family.

Illinois State Police (ISP) Troop 1 Captain Joseph Blanchette has announced enforcement figures and activity for June.

ISP Troop 1 officers issued 813 citations, 741 written warnings, and made 27 criminal arrests during the month of June. Troopers issued 287 citations for speeding, 47 citations for distracted driving violations, and 49 citations for occupant restraint violations.
